Ingredients
Plain Water
0.5 small cup (100g)
Jau (Barley) flour
0.5 cup (100g)
Oats Flour
0.5 cup (100g)
Instructions
Cooking Steps
In a bowl, mix the jaw atta and oats atta together.
Gradually add warm water and knead the mixture to form a dough. add it slowly to achieve the right consistency.
Shape the dough into ball, Gently press and flatten the dough ball to form a round roti.
Heat a non-stick skillet or tawa over medium heat.
Carefully transfer the flattened roti onto the skillet and cook for about 1-2 minutes on each side
Press the roti gently with a spatula while cooking to ensure it cooks evenly.
Once both sides are cooked, remove the roti from the skillet and serve warm.
